Cereal drinks typically contain a blend of water, cereal grains (such as oats, barley, or rice), sweeteners (like sugar or honey), and flavorings. They may also include vitamins, minerals, and sometimes dairy or plant-based milk alternatives to enhance nutritional content and taste. Additional ingredients can include stabilizers, emulsifiers, and natural flavors to improve texture and shelf life. Overall, the specific compounds can vary based on the brand and formulation.

No. Elements cannot be broken down by chemical means, compounds can. Some substances in the cereal may dissolve in water, but they do not break down. Once you eat and start digesting the cereal, then compounds start to break down.
Cereal is not a mineral. Minerals are naturally occurring inorganic compounds with a crystalline structure, while cereal is a food product made from grains.
Cereal is NOT a compound, NEITHER a homogeneous mixture, BUT yes, it is a heterogeneous mixture
